Metodologias ativas de aprendizagem e a teoria da carga cognitiva para a construção de caminhos no ensino de programação de computadores

Detalhes bibliográficos
Autor(a) principal: Berssanette, João Henrique
Data de Publicação: 2021
Tipo de documento: Tese
Idioma: por
Título da fonte: Repositório Institucional da UTFPR (da Universidade Tecnológica Federal do Paraná (RIUT))
Texto Completo: http://repositorio.utfpr.edu.br/jspui/handle/1/25526
Resumo: Acompanha produção técnica: Construindo “novos” caminhos para o ensino de programação por meio do uso de metodologias ativas de aprendizagem e teoria da carga cognitiva
id UTFPR-12_4e004708380c1bcf34e0acb74b7f2bd7
oai_identifier_str oai:repositorio.utfpr.edu.br:1/25526
network_acronym_str UTFPR-12
network_name_str Repositório Institucional da UTFPR (da Universidade Tecnológica Federal do Paraná (RIUT))
repository_id_str
spelling Metodologias ativas de aprendizagem e a teoria da carga cognitiva para a construção de caminhos no ensino de programação de computadoresActive learning methodologies and the cognitive load theory in building paths for teaching computer programmingAprendizagem ativaProgramação (Computadores)Ensino - MetodologiaPrática de ensinoInovações educacionaisActive learningComputer programmingTeaching - MethodologyStudent teachingEducational innovationsCNPQ::CIENCIAS HUMANASEngenharia/Tecnologia/GestãoAcompanha produção técnica: Construindo “novos” caminhos para o ensino de programação por meio do uso de metodologias ativas de aprendizagem e teoria da carga cognitivaGiven the current relevance of computers for society, a drive towards enhancing computer programming related skills has become noticeable. However, learning to program computers is no simple or trivial task since programming is a highly cognitive skill, requiring mastery of multiple aspects. Thus, literature evidences that the teaching/learning process for computer programming has become a challenge for both, teachers and students, resulting in high levels of unsuccess. The objective of this paper is to evaluate the contribution of a pedagogic approach based on associating Active Learning Methodologies and the Theory of Cognitive Load in teaching computer programming, from the faculty standpoint. To this end, a study of mixed methods was undertaken with faculty from the areas of Computers Sciences, Informatics and other similar, who teach subjects related to computer programming. The data was obtained from a continued qualification, by way of questionnaires, activities, participation and/or interaction records from the participating faculty members. The scope of the analysis of the data obtained is the perspective of the faculty participating in this qualification on the proposed pedagogic approach. The results obtained show that, from the perspective of participating faculty, the proposed pedagogic approach contributes to helping and guiding faculty members in the didactic-pedagogic organization of the teaching/learning process and in planning and structuring classes, aligning this process to the student’s capacity to assimilate, so as to broaden the contextualization of contents and concepts that, in their turn, increase satisfaction, motivation, interest, and involvement, engagement as well as the protagonism of learners. Further, the existence of a synergistic potential in the association proposed between Active Learning Methodologies and the Theory of Cognitive Load was evidenced, given that these methodologies can be more effective or, yet, enhanced, through deploying the concepts of the Theory of Cognitive Load, enabling achieving a balance point between the benefits of active student participation and costs relative to the higher cognitive load involved. This leads to the understanding that, from the faculty standpoint, the pedagogic approach proposed has potential to make a significant contribution to the teaching of computer programming, through technical and methodological support, driving the development of adequate educational practices, aligned to contemporary education and the needs and capacity of learners. These are fitting in reducing the lack of success in learning programming skills.Em virtude da relevância dos computadores para a sociedade, tem-se notabilizado o fomento das habilidades relacionadas à programação de computadores. Entretanto, aprender a programar computadores não é uma tarefa simples, tampouco trivial, pois a programação é uma habilidade altamente cognitiva, a qual requer múltiplos domínios. Por isso, a literatura evidencia que o processo de ensino/aprendizagem de programação de computadores tem se constituído um desafio para professores e estudantes, ocasionando elevados níveis de insucesso. Esta pesquisa teve por objetivo avaliar a contribuição de uma abordagem pedagógica baseada na associação de Metodologias Ativas de Aprendizagem e a Teoria da Carga Cognitiva para o ensino de programação de computadores, a partir das perspectivas dos docentes. Para tanto, foi desenvolvido um estudo de métodos mistos com docentes das áreas de Computação, Informática e afins, que lecionam matérias relacionadas à programação de computadores. Os dados foram obtidos a partir de uma formação continuada, por intermédio de questionários, atividades, registros de participações e/ou interações dos docentes participantes. A análise dos dados apurados tem como escopo as perspectivas dos docentes participantes dessa formação quanto à abordagem pedagógica proposta. Os resultados obtidos mostram que, nas perspectivas dos docentes participantes, a abordagem pedagógica proposta contribui para auxiliar e orientar o docente na organização didático-pedagógica do processo de ensino/aprendizagem e no planejamento e estruturação das aulas, alinhando esse processo às capacidades de assimilação dos estudantes, de forma a ampliar a contextualização dos conteúdos e conceitos que, por sua vez, aumentam a satisfação, a motivação, o interesse, o envolvimento, o engajamento e o protagonismo dos discentes. Ademais, verificou-se que a associação proposta de Metodologias Ativas de Aprendizagem e a Teoria da Carga Cognitiva têm um potencial sinérgico, uma vez que essas metodologias podem ser mais efetivas ou, ainda, aperfeiçoadas, a partir dos conceitos da teoria da carga cognitiva, possibilitando um ponto de equilíbrio entre os benefícios da participação ativa dos estudantes e os custos relacionados à maior carga cognitiva envolvida. Com isso, depreende-se que, nas perspectivas dos docentes, a abordagem pedagógica proposta tem potencial para contribuir significativamente para o ensino de programação de computadores, por meio do suporte teórico e metodológico, propiciando o desenvolvimento de práticas educativas adequadas, alinhadas à educação contemporânea e às necessidades e capacidades dos aprendizes. Essas práticas são condizentes com a redução dos insucessos no aprendizado de programação.Universidade Tecnológica Federal do ParanáPonta GrossaBrasilPrograma de Pós-Graduação em Ensino de Ciência e TecnologiaUTFPRFrancisco, Antonio Carlos dehttps://orcid.org/0000-0003-0401-4445http://lattes.cnpq.br/6457056051910603Francisco, Antonio Carlos dehttp://lattes.cnpq.br/6457056051910603Koscianski, Andréhttps://orcid.org/0000-0003-3071-0305http://lattes.cnpq.br/7693781941703733Matos, Eloiza Aparecida Silva Avila dehttps://orcid.org/0000-0002-2857-4159http://lattes.cnpq.br/0394414374162107Mattar Neto, João Augustohttps://orcid.org/0000-0001-6265-6150http://lattes.cnpq.br/9511610526352732Pedro, Neuza Sofia Guerreirohttps://orcid.org/0000-0001-9571-8602https://orcid.org/0000-0001-9571-8602Berssanette, João Henrique2021-07-08T12:44:06Z2021-07-08T12:44:06Z2021-06-21info: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/doctoralThesisapplication/pdfapplication/pdfBERSSANETTE, João Henrique. Metodologias ativas de aprendizagem e a teoria da carga cognitiva para a construção de caminhos no ensino de programação de computadores. 2021. Tese (Doutorado em Ensino de Ciência e Tecnologia) - Universidade Tecnológica Federal do Paraná, Ponta Grossa, 2021.http://repositorio.utfpr.edu.br/jspui/handle/1/25526porhttp://creativecommons.org/licenses/by-nc-sa/4.0/info:eu-repo/semantics/openAccessreponame:Repositório Institucional da UTFPR (da Universidade Tecnológica Federal do Paraná (RIUT))instname:Universidade Tecnológica Federal do Paraná (UTFPR)instacron:UTFPR2021-07-09T06:04:08Zoai:repositorio.utfpr.edu.br:1/25526Repositório InstitucionalPUBhttp://repositorio.utfpr.edu.br:8080/oai/requestriut@utfpr.edu.br || sibi@utfpr.edu.bropendoar:2021-07-09T06:04:08Repositório Institucional da UTFPR (da Universidade Tecnológica Federal do Paraná (RIUT)) - Universidade Tecnológica Federal do Paraná (UTFPR)false
dc.title.none.fl_str_mv Metodologias ativas de aprendizagem e a teoria da carga cognitiva para a construção de caminhos no ensino de programação de computadores
Active learning methodologies and the cognitive load theory in building paths for teaching computer programming
title Metodologias ativas de aprendizagem e a teoria da carga cognitiva para a construção de caminhos no ensino de programação de computadores
spellingShingle Metodologias ativas de aprendizagem e a teoria da carga cognitiva para a construção de caminhos no ensino de programação de computadores
Berssanette, João Henrique
Aprendizagem ativa
Programação (Computadores)
Ensino - Metodologia
Prática de ensino
Inovações educacionais
Active learning
Computer programming
Teaching - Methodology
Student teaching
Educational innovations
CNPQ::CIENCIAS HUMANAS
Engenharia/Tecnologia/Gestão
title_short Metodologias ativas de aprendizagem e a teoria da carga cognitiva para a construção de caminhos no ensino de programação de computadores
title_full Metodologias ativas de aprendizagem e a teoria da carga cognitiva para a construção de caminhos no ensino de programação de computadores
title_fullStr Metodologias ativas de aprendizagem e a teoria da carga cognitiva para a construção de caminhos no ensino de programação de computadores
title_full_unstemmed Metodologias ativas de aprendizagem e a teoria da carga cognitiva para a construção de caminhos no ensino de programação de computadores
title_sort Metodologias ativas de aprendizagem e a teoria da carga cognitiva para a construção de caminhos no ensino de programação de computadores
author Berssanette, João Henrique
author_facet Berssanette, João Henrique
author_role author
dc.contributor.none.fl_str_mv Francisco, Antonio Carlos de
https://orcid.org/0000-0003-0401-4445
http://lattes.cnpq.br/6457056051910603
Francisco, Antonio Carlos de
http://lattes.cnpq.br/6457056051910603
Koscianski, André
https://orcid.org/0000-0003-3071-0305
http://lattes.cnpq.br/7693781941703733
Matos, Eloiza Aparecida Silva Avila de
https://orcid.org/0000-0002-2857-4159
http://lattes.cnpq.br/0394414374162107
Mattar Neto, João Augusto
https://orcid.org/0000-0001-6265-6150
http://lattes.cnpq.br/9511610526352732
Pedro, Neuza Sofia Guerreiro
https://orcid.org/0000-0001-9571-8602
https://orcid.org/0000-0001-9571-8602
dc.contributor.author.fl_str_mv Berssanette, João Henrique
dc.subject.por.fl_str_mv Aprendizagem ativa
Programação (Computadores)
Ensino - Metodologia
Prática de ensino
Inovações educacionais
Active learning
Computer programming
Teaching - Methodology
Student teaching
Educational innovations
CNPQ::CIENCIAS HUMANAS
Engenharia/Tecnologia/Gestão
topic Aprendizagem ativa
Programação (Computadores)
Ensino - Metodologia
Prática de ensino
Inovações educacionais
Active learning
Computer programming
Teaching - Methodology
Student teaching
Educational innovations
CNPQ::CIENCIAS HUMANAS
Engenharia/Tecnologia/Gestão
description Acompanha produção técnica: Construindo “novos” caminhos para o ensino de programação por meio do uso de metodologias ativas de aprendizagem e teoria da carga cognitiva
publishDate 2021
dc.date.none.fl_str_mv 2021-07-08T12:44:06Z
2021-07-08T12:44:06Z
2021-06-21
dc.type.status.fl_str_mv info:eu-repo/semantics/publishedVersion
dc.type.driver.fl_str_mv info:eu-repo/semantics/doctoralThesis
format doctoralThesis
status_str publishedVersion
dc.identifier.uri.fl_str_mv BERSSANETTE, João Henrique. Metodologias ativas de aprendizagem e a teoria da carga cognitiva para a construção de caminhos no ensino de programação de computadores. 2021. Tese (Doutorado em Ensino de Ciência e Tecnologia) - Universidade Tecnológica Federal do Paraná, Ponta Grossa, 2021.
http://repositorio.utfpr.edu.br/jspui/handle/1/25526
identifier_str_mv BERSSANETTE, João Henrique. Metodologias ativas de aprendizagem e a teoria da carga cognitiva para a construção de caminhos no ensino de programação de computadores. 2021. Tese (Doutorado em Ensino de Ciência e Tecnologia) - Universidade Tecnológica Federal do Paraná, Ponta Grossa, 2021.
url http://repositorio.utfpr.edu.br/jspui/handle/1/25526
dc.language.iso.fl_str_mv por
language por
dc.rights.driver.fl_str_mv http://creativecommons.org/licenses/by-nc-sa/4.0/
info:eu-repo/semantics/openAccess
rights_invalid_str_mv http://creativecommons.org/licenses/by-nc-sa/4.0/
eu_rights_str_mv openAccess
dc.format.none.fl_str_mv application/pdf
application/pdf
dc.publisher.none.fl_str_mv Universidade Tecnológica Federal do Paraná
Ponta Grossa
Brasil
Programa de Pós-Graduação em Ensino de Ciência e Tecnologia
UTFPR
publisher.none.fl_str_mv Universidade Tecnológica Federal do Paraná
Ponta Grossa
Brasil
Programa de Pós-Graduação em Ensino de Ciência e Tecnologia
UTFPR
dc.source.none.fl_str_mv reponame:Repositório Institucional da UTFPR (da Universidade Tecnológica Federal do Paraná (RIUT))
instname:Universidade Tecnológica Federal do Paraná (UTFPR)
instacron:UTFPR
instname_str Universidade Tecnológica Federal do Paraná (UTFPR)
instacron_str UTFPR
institution UTFPR
reponame_str Repositório Institucional da UTFPR (da Universidade Tecnológica Federal do Paraná (RIUT))
collection Repositório Institucional da UTFPR (da Universidade Tecnológica Federal do Paraná (RIUT))
repository.name.fl_str_mv Repositório Institucional da UTFPR (da Universidade Tecnológica Federal do Paraná (RIUT)) - Universidade Tecnológica Federal do Paraná (UTFPR)
repository.mail.fl_str_mv riut@utfpr.edu.br || sibi@utfpr.edu.br
_version_ 1850498092515721216